Blended learning and digital classrooms
Blended learning merges face-to-face instruction with digital platforms, creating an environment that balances structure and flexibility. Instead of replacing teachers, technology amplifies their reach. Students can review materials online, collaborate in shared digital workspaces, and receive instant feedback.
Digital classrooms also leverage cloud-based learning management systems to track progress in real time. This data-driven approach allows educators to intervene early, personalize instruction, and support diverse learning speeds. It’s not just convenient, it’s strategic.
Interactive and collaborative learning models
Learning thrives in interaction. Collaborative projects, peer-to-peer discussions, and inquiry-based activities stimulate deeper comprehension than rote memorization ever could. When students debate, create, and solve problems together, they build both cognitive and social intelligence.
John Hattie, a renowned education researcher, once stated, “The biggest effects on student learning occur when teachers become learners of their own teaching.” His research reinforces the importance of feedback-rich, interactive environments that empower both educators and students.
Personalized learning experiences
Personalization is redefining how students experience education. Adaptive learning technologies analyze performance patterns and adjust content difficulty accordingly. This ensures learners neither feel overwhelmed nor disengaged.
Instead of forcing everyone through the same pace, personalized learning respects individual differences. It supports differentiated instruction, targeted interventions, and flexible pathways, key pillars in the evolution of global education systems.

Artificial intelligence in education
Artificial intelligence is revolutionizing assessment and support systems. AI-powered platforms can evaluate assignments, recommend tailored exercises, and identify learning gaps before they widen.
According to Andreas Schleicher, Director for Education and Skills at the OECD, “Technology is only as powerful as the pedagogy behind it.” His insight highlights a critical truth: AI must complement sound instructional design. When implemented ethically, it increases efficiency while preserving educational integrity.
Virtual reality and immersive learning
Virtual reality introduces experiential depth to abstract concepts. Students can explore historical landmarks, simulate scientific experiments, or examine complex anatomical structures in immersive 3D environments.
This kind of experiential learning dramatically increases retention rates. It transforms theoretical knowledge into lived experience, making lessons memorable and impactful.
Online platforms for flexible learning
Flexible learning platforms have expanded access beyond physical classrooms. From micro-credentials to professional certifications, online education supports lifelong learners at every stage.
These systems allow asynchronous participation, enabling students to balance work, family, and education. Accessibility, scalability, and convenience make online platforms indispensable in modern academic frameworks.
